Answer:
Legal disputes are common in the early stages of a startup, and how you handle them can significantly affect the future of your business. Here’s a step-by-step guide on managing legal disputes effectively:

Step 1: Prevent Disputes with Clear Contracts 📝
One of the best ways to avoid disputes is to have clear, well-drafted contracts. Ensure that all business agreements, whether with co-founders, employees, or partners, are documented with precise terms, responsibilities, and obligations. 📑

Step 2: Communicate Openly and Early 🗣️
If a legal issue arises, address it early. Open communication with the parties involved can prevent the situation from escalating into a bigger conflict. Often, small misunderstandings can be resolved with a conversation. 🗨️

Step 3: Seek Legal Advice 🧑‍⚖️
Legal advice is essential for startups, especially when facing disputes. A lawyer specializing in startup law can help you navigate the complexities of business regulations and offer solutions tailored to your situation. ⚖️

Step 4: Use Mediation or Alternative Dispute Resolution (ADR) ⚖️
If a legal dispute cannot be resolved through communication, consider using mediation or ADR. These alternative methods are less costly and time-consuming compared to litigation, helping you reach a solution without going to court. 🕊️

Step 5: Formal Legal Action (If Necessary) 🏛️
If informal resolution methods fail, you may need to pursue formal legal action. This might involve filing a lawsuit in court. However, litigation should be considered a last resort, as it can be costly and time-consuming. ⚖️

Step 6: Protect Your Intellectual Property (IP) 🛡️
Startups are vulnerable to IP theft, so protecting your ideas, trademarks, patents, and copyrights is crucial. A strong IP strategy can protect your innovations and give you the legal right to pursue action if they are infringed. 🧑‍💻

Step 7: Learn and Adapt 📚
Each legal dispute offers valuable lessons for your business. Make adjustments to your contracts, communication, and business structure to avoid similar issues in the future. Legal learning is part of growing a successful startup! 🚀
